What is the difference between Backend Insurance Verification vs Front Desk Insurance Verification?

AspectBackend Insurance VerificationFront Desk Insurance Verification
Primary ResponsibilitiesProcessing insurance claims, verifying coverage electronically, and handling billing issuesChecking insurance information at patient check-in, collecting documents, and initial verification
Work EnvironmentOffice-based, often in billing or administrative departmentsFront desk, reception area, patient check-in stations
Required CredentialsKnowledge of insurance policies, billing software, and healthcare regulationsBasic insurance knowledge, customer service skills, and administrative training
Common UsageUsed in billing departments for detailed claim processingUsed at the point of patient intake for initial verification

Backend Insurance Verification involves processing insurance claims and verifying coverage electronically within billing departments, while Front Desk Insurance Verification focuses on initial patient insurance checks at the front desk. Both roles require insurance knowledge but differ in responsibilities and work environment.

Who We Are: Founded in 2007, SimIS Inc. is an innovative information technology solution Veteran Owned Small Business (VOSB) that models future environments, requirements, and capabilities, and then secures the enterprise from internal and external threats compliant with Federal, State, and industry standard governance to ensure client mission success. Our performance standard is “excellence,” with an outcomes-based, quality focus in our services and products, guided by our core values of honesty (in word and deed), relationships (confidence and trust with clients and partners), teamwork (shared goals, mission, and purpose), loyalty (allegiance to our client and team), and importance of others (work and win as a team). SimIS is currently recruiting for the listed position.
Job Description:
SimIS is seeking contractor SME support to provide technical and analytical support to Operational Test and Evaluation Force (T&E) in the definition, conduct, and analysis of structured Operational Test and Evaluation (OT&E) of US Navy Undersea Warfare systems. As the Data Engineer, you will apply current knowledge of the Navy and multi-service missions, operations, logistics, management, and organizational responsibilities to plan and organize work tasks leading to the successful execution of test planning, collecting data, and performing reconstruction and analysis for complex test and evaluation projects.
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
  • BS degree in in Data Science, Computer/Information Science, Information Systems Management, Digitization Management, Management of Information Systems, Mathematics, or Engineering.
  • 4 years of demonstrated experience and proficiency in data analysis functions such as data mining, data cleaning, data integration, data reduction/manipulation, data transformation, data visualization, and data analysis of small to large data sets.
  • Demonstrated proficiency in data analysis in a programming or statistical software suite such as: R, Python, SAS, SPSS, STATA, Tableau, and/or PowerBI for small to large data sets.
  • Proficient in the design, implementation, and operation of data management systems to support management of applicable test data.
  • Demonstrated experience in the development of data collection plans to include methods, and storage of raw and processed test data.
  • Experience in the verification and validation of data collection and accreditation plans in support of test planning.
  • Experience in the coordination of the equipment necessary to implement data collection during testing.
Technical Skills:
  • Knowledge of the incorporation of Artificial Intelligence (AI)/ Machine Learning (ML) into data analysis software is preferred.
  • Database Management.
  • Analysis of structured and unstructured data.
  • Backend database technologies (SQL, NoSQL, HPC, etc.),
  • Possess a Certified Analytics Professional certification.
